# datcnv_date = Jun 02 2014 10:12:26, 7.22.5 [datcnv_vars = 13] # datcnv_in = P:\Cruise_Data_Processing\2014-01\RAW\CTD\2014-01-0013.hex P:\Crui se_Data_Processing\2014-01\Processing\doc\2014-01-ctd.XMLCON # datcnv_skipover = 0 # datcnv_ox_hysteresis_correction = yes # wildedit_date = Jun 02 2014 10:21:39, 7.22.5 # wildedit_in = P:\Cruise_Data_Processing\2014-01\Processing\convert\2014-01-001 3.cnv # wildedit_pass1_nstd = 2.0 # wildedit_pass2_nstd = 5.0 # wildedit_pass2_mindelta = 0.000e+000 # wildedit_npoint = 50 # wildedit_vars = prDM t090C t190C c0S/m c1S/m # wildedit_excl_bad_scans = yes # alignctd_date = Jun 02 2014 12:04:05, 7.22.5 # alignctd_in = P:\Cruise_Data_Processing\2014-01\Processing\wildedit\2014-01-00 13.cnv # alignctd_adv = sbeox0V 4.000 # celltm_date = Jun 02 2014 16:10:26, 7.22.5 # celltm_in = P:\Cruise_Data_Processing\2014-01\Processing\align\2014-01-0013.cn v # celltm_alpha = 0.0300, 0.0300 # celltm_tau = 9.0000, 7.0000 # celltm_temp_sensor_use_for_cond = primary, secondary # Derive_date = Jun 03 2014 09:45:17, 7.22.5 [derive_vars = 4] # Derive_in = P:\Cruise_Data_Processing\2014-01\Processing\celltm\2014-01-0013.c nv P:\Cruise_Data_Processing\2014-01\Processing\doc\2014-01-ctd.XMLCON # derive_time_window_docdt = seconds: 0.5 # derive_ox_tau_correction = yes # derive_time_window_dzdt = seconds: 0.5 # file_type = ascii END* Remarks from CTDEDIT: CTDEDIT was used to remove some records near the surface and many records corrupted by shed wakes; salinity was cleaned and some salinity points were removed. --------------------------------------------------------------------------------- Data Processing Notes: ---------------------- Transmissivity, Fluorescence and PAR data are nominal and unedited except that some records were removed in editing temperature and salinity. For details on how the transmissivity calibration parameters were calculated see the document in folder "\cruise_data\documents\transmissivity". Dissolved oxygen was calibrated using the method described in SeaBird Application Note #64-2, June 2012 revision, except that a small offset in the fit was allowed. The Oxygen:Dissolved:SBE data are considered, very roughly, to be: ±0.8mL/L from 0 to 100db ±0.6mL/L from 100db to 300db ±0.2mL/L from 300db to 800db ±0.05mL/L below 800db The primary CTD salinity channel was used for events #41 and 43, so it was recalibrated to match the secondary channel which was selected for all other casts.
